Because custom operating system images can technically be injected with malicious rootkits or trojans, always download exclusively from well-reviewed, community-verified repository links. Once a file is downloaded, verify its structural integrity by checking its SHA-256 hash against known good listings provided by the build's original creator before allowing it to boot into a hardware setup.
